Las ecuaciones de la vida | Mauricio Rangel | TEDxUPMP
En esta charla Mauricio Rangel nos habla sobre aquellas situaciones que nos hacen forjar un carácter y una personalidad aprendiendo que todo es temporal y pasajero Médico veterinario y zootecnista por parte de la universidad Mesoamericana, Licenciado en Derecho por parte del Instituto de Estudios Universitarios campus Puebla. Experiencia de tres años en clínica privada y en gobierno del Estado de Puebla en el Instituto De Bienestar Animal órgano desconcentrado de la Secretaria de Medio Ambiente. Encargado de contingencias y diligenciaría, desarrolló trabajo de medicina forense, así como trabajo en conjunto con Fiscalía del Estado de Puebla en orientaciones y asesoría legal. De la misma forma fue responsable de la coordinación de contingencias en apoyo a los animales afectados por explosiones rescatando alrededor de 2500 especies en todo ese tiempo. Tanatológo con certificación por parte de la Universidad Anáhuac Campus Puebla y la Asociación Española de Psicología Sanitaria, firmada en Valencia 2025. Finalmente, activista animal y ha trabajado en la Reforma a las Leyes de Bienestar Animal. Ms. Sonal Ambani is a globally exhibited sculptor whose works in steel and bronze explore resilience, digital culture, and gender equality. In 2024, she received the inaugural Motwani Jadeja Art Prize for her monumental Unity Dome – Voices of Women, adding to earlier honors such as the Times of India Women Power Award (2019), the Women of Excellence Award – FICCI FLO (2017), and the Pfeiffer Peace Prize (2005).Her sculptures have been showcased at the Venice Biennale, DIFC Sculpture Park, and India Art Fair, and are part of royal and private collections worldwide. Beyond her art, Sonal is deeply committed to social causes. As founder of the Cancer Screening Research Trust and a member of the United Nations Development Fund for Women, she integrates humanitarian values into her creative practice. A portion of proceeds from her work continues to support cancer awareness, reflecting her belief that art must serve both society and the spirit.
